Are there local banks in Saint Jo that specialize in agricultural or land loans for purchasing property in Montague County?

Yes, both First State Bank and Citizens National Bank have a strong history of serving the agricultural community and are deeply familiar with the local land values and economy of Montague County. They offer specialized loan products for purchasing farmland, operating lines of credit for agricultural operations, and equipment financing. Their local loan officers can provide personalized service and understand the unique financial needs of farmers and ranchers in the area.

For those seeking a member-owned alternative, Texoma Community Credit Union is a fantastic choice. While its main branches are in nearby cities, it serves many residents in our area. Credit unions operate on a not-for-profit model, which often translates to lower fees, competitive loan rates, and higher yields on savings accounts. Becoming a member means you have a say in how the institution is run, fostering a powerful sense of financial partnership. They are particularly worth considering for auto loans, credit cards, and checking accounts designed to save you money.
